This mid-summer Sportive is sure to test your seasons training to date. With its unforgiving, but quintessentially British country side vistas held entirely in the Cotswold District – as Britain’s largest Area of outstanding natural beauty, this will be one sportive you won’t want to miss out on. Leaving from the magnificent Cheltenham racecourse, home of the Cheltenham Festival, and the Gold Cup, it has everything facility you come to expect from the Wiggle Super Series events. There are three routes to choose from, Epic 105 miles, Standard 75 miles and Short at 40 miles, all of which are designed to involve the riders in this truly beautiful area.
